How to Verify Safety

Run pip audit or safety check. Review on PyPI for download stats.

You can also check the trust score via API: GET /v1/preflight?target=catboost

Key Safety Concerns for Python package

When evaluating any Python package, watch for: dependency vulnerabilities, malicious uploads, maintenance status.
